A challenging half-day journey along the coastline of Manuel Antonio, this ocean kayaking adventure takes you past islands and inlets for incredible views and bird watching.

Ocean kayaking is an exciting way to experience Costa Rica's marine and coastal wonders, and much easier than river kayaking, making these trips open to experienced and inexperienced kayakers.

You will have the opportunity to get a close look at a myriad of life below and above the ocean's surface, from flying fish and sea turtles to frigate birds and pelicans. The group will also explore some hard-to-reach offshore islands and coastal estuaries.

What to Bring

Bathing suit, sunscreen, sandals, sun-visor or hat, dry clothing, towel, plastic bags for wet clothing and original, copy or photo of your ID or passport for all the members.

What's included

Bilingual kayak guide, single or tandem kayaks, high quality equipment, lunch (it is provided after the tour).

Snorkeling in Manuel Antonio

The ocean off the coast of Manuel Antonio National Park is known for its reefs and calm waters that allow for easy snorkeling. Snorkelers that take the plunge here will get to see giant schools of tropical fish. Probably the most talked-about species is the bright, neon-colored parrotfish. These fish nibble on the reef and are an essential component of the reef’s ecosystem.
